The question

What is the ruling on the state allocating a car and guards for the head of a department, knowing that this falls under the principle of taking precautions for security considerations?

The answer

The fundamental principle regarding public funds is the prohibition of disposing of them unjustly, unless there is a legitimate Islamic interest that necessitates such disposal, while adhering to Islamic regulations, such as avoiding favoritism and extravagance. In such a case, there is no harm.

Accordingly, if there is a legitimate Islamic interest in providing a car for the protection of a specific official, and there is no transgression of Islamic limits in doing so, then there is no harm.
